Tips for drying clothes.
In good weather, consider hanging clothes outside to dry. It's free.
Don't over-dry clothes that you are going to iron.
Take clothes out while they are still slightly damp to reduce the need for ironing - another big energy user. Over-drying can cause shrinkage, generates static electricity and shortens fabric life.
Clean the dryer filter after each use.
A clogged filter will restrict airflow and reduce dryer performance. Once or twice per year, clear lint and dust from the venting system and from the interior and back of the dryer.
Dry full loads when possible, but be careful not to overfill the dryer, because air needs to circulate around the clothes.
Reduce drying time.
If your washer has spin options, choose a high spin speed or extended spin, to reduce the amount of remaining moisture.
